Note: We have organized the cemeteries in our Gazetteer based on a problem that we had while working on our own genealogy. Without specifying the cemeteries involved, we found an ancestor that we believed to have been buried in one cemetery was actually buried elsewhere.

We discovered that his burial had been refused at the last moment and the family had scrambled to make new arrangements. By looking at nearby cemeteries, the surrounding communities and in newspapers of the period, we were finally able to locate his burial site.

Should you find yourself in the same situation, we hope that our Gazetteer helps you discover your lost ancestor.

The Location of the Cave Spring Cemetery ...

We are using the following GPS coordinates (latitude and longitude) for the Cave Spring Cemetery

Lat:   34.1181°   (34° 7' 5")

Lon:   -85.3280°   (-85° 19' 40")

The Cave Spring Cemetery is located in Floyd County<2>.

The county seat for Floyd County is located in Rome. Rome lies 13 miles [20.9 km]<3> to the northeast of the Cave Spring Cemetery .

Establishment of the Cave Spring Cemetery ...

The Cave Spring Cemetery was established in 1838.
